Address

ecash:qppj7wedduzhu0n4f7nrgnmq68lhwm33qgthc0r050Copy

Total Received

2630.64 XEC

Total Sent

2625.17 XEC

№ Transactions

15

Final Balance

5.47 XEC

Transactions
Filter